Things You'll Need:
- 1 package of hamburger meat
- 1 pack of hard shell tacos
- 2 cups of grated cheddar cheese
- 1 diced Tomato
- 1 bunch Green onions, chopped
- 1/2 head shredded Lettuce
- 1 container of Salsa
- 1 guacamole
- 1 can black sliced olives
- Container Sour cream
- Frying pan
- 1 pack taco seasoning mix
-
Step 1
Add hamburger meat to pan and cook till cooked through, at this point you will want to drain fat into a metal container. Add a cup of water and taco seasoning mix to meat and let simmer.
-
Step 2
Put taco shell's into oven on low heat, this is just to heat up shell's to serve. You will then want to start setting out your other ingredients on table.
-
Step 3
Put lettuce/cheddar cheese/onions/tomato's/olives into seperate bowls on table. Also include containers of salsa/sour cream and guacamole on table.
-
Step 4
It is time to eat, pull taco shell's from oven and put on plate. Let everyone dish up and enjoy the taco's!
